Privacy Fence Installation in Wichita, KS
Privacy fence installation services provide homeowners with the opportunity to create a secure and private outdoor space. These projects typically involve constructing fences that block visibility from neighboring properties, enhancing both privacy and security. Common materials used include wood, vinyl, and composite options, allowing property owners to choose a style that complements their home’s aesthetic. Privacy fences are often requested for backyards, patios, or pool areas, where added seclusion is desired for relaxation and outdoor activities.
Before requesting privacy fence installation, property owners should consider factors such as local zoning regulations, property lines, and any restrictions on fence height or materials. It’s also helpful to determine the desired level of privacy and the type of fencing that best suits the landscape and climate. Clarifying these details can ensure the project aligns with property goals, provides long-lasting results, and complies with community guidelines.

Privacy Fence Installation Questions
What are the benefits of a privacy fence? Privacy fences provide increased security, reduce noise, and create a secluded outdoor space for relaxation and activities.
What materials are commonly used for privacy fences? Common options include wood, vinyl, and composite materials, each offering different levels of durability and style.
How high should a privacy fence be? Typically, privacy fences range from six to eight feet tall to effectively block views and ensure privacy.
Are privacy fences suitable for all types of properties? Privacy fences can be installed on most residential properties, whether for backyard privacy or boundary marking.
